So, this whole business of the Marvel and DC universes meeting up and eventually merging partially involved this new character, Access. While ostensibly having the powers of a reality-altering god, he's currently just managed panic-induced teleportation. Naturally, such power being held by a red shirt draws the attention of our "hero."
Meet Dr. Strangefate, PhD of Occult Pimpology.

And his Gallery of Mystic Hos!

Strangefate catches up his minions (and the readers) on what exactly has been going on.

The three do their best to bag and tag the Human MacGuffin.



Strangefate dismisses the others to have some "alone time" with Access. (note the occult pimp cane)

Despite the Rite of Overdone Symbolism, Access does not have the means within his corporeal being to avert the collapse of the merged universes. Strangefate lets him go so he canangst in private bemoan the burden of his pimping prowess.

Date: 2010-03-20 09:56 pm (UTC)Longer version - On a distant human (or close enough) populated world, a strange alignment of their three suns causes many of the laws of science to fail, and the laws of magic to restored. With mechanics, electronics and electricity out of commission, their high-tech society falls and feudal barbarism returns in short order.
Merklynn, who has waited a thousand years for the return of magic, sets a series of challenges to any who seek to claim one of a number of magical staffs which grant specific power to the wielder. He is neutral about HOW they are used, so long as they are used, and so we end up with the Spectral Knights, who seek to use magic to restore justice and peace, and the Darkling Lords, who use their magic to enforce their fairly tyrannical rule.
As he is the only one who can recharge their magic, the rather Machiavellian Merklynn frequently calls on both teams to do his dirty work, sometimes setting them against each other, sometimes making them work towards the same goal. As the series progresses both sides chafe under this, and Merklynn gets a little peeved that they're not showing due deference to him.
It's a great little series, sadly lasting on 13 episodes. A second year of the nifty action figure line was planned, and would presumably have led to new season, but alas, Sunbow Animation (Who had made Transformers, GI Joe, Jem and many others) went out of business, so the series was cancelled.
